To describe the book to be published in the next two months:
-
The title of the book is Hexameter in Story and Verse.
-
For the book, I have written or transcribed five stories of considerable length for children into Hexameter. Children’s stories in Hexameter have been literally non-existent. Evangeline by Longfellow has been about the only one relatively suitable for class 5 when it is given. Many paintings are to be seen in my children’s stories.
-
The old Masters, Homer Goethe, Longfellow, Yeats and Kingsley are in the second section.
-
Poetry and poetry in translation is also present, several of which I have done including the Metamorphoses of Plant and Animal by Goethe
-
Then there’s a section of essays about Speech and Drama and Anthroposophical Therapy.
-
Interspersed in the whole book are my paintings.
